A Las Vegas Wedding is Hassle Free

The State of Nevada’s laid-back marriage laws make it one of the
easiest places in the world to obtain a marriage license and to
get married. There are no blood tests required and no waiting
period. Just a quick trip to the courthouse, show some
identification (driver‘s license or passport), lay out $55 in
cash and you’re on your way.

What’s more, planning your wedding couldn‘t be easier.
Full-service Las Vegas wedding chapels and hotels with wedding
chapels typically have a wedding coordinator ready to personally
attend to your wedding arrangements right down to the last
detail. Your wedding flowers, music, photography, video or any
preparation of your ceremony can all be handled by phone or even
online.

A Las Vegas Wedding is Cheaper

No doubt about it, a Las Vegas wedding will save you money.
There are services to match just about any budget. You can have
a “just do the job” wedding ceremony for as little as $100. Not
a bad deal. A traditional Las Vegas wedding package for around
$200 will include chapel fee, a video of the ceremony, basic
flower and photo arrangements and chapel time.

On the other hand, if you want a more stylish wedding with all
the bells and whistles, you can expect to pay up to a few
thousand dollars depending on the package you choose.
Nonetheless, compared to a do-it-yourself traditional wedding,
which averages around $22,000, you’ve saved yourself a bundle.

A Las Vegas Wedding Allows You Plenty of Flexibility

You don’t have to lock in the church, minister or reception hall
a year in advance. In Las Vegas, you can book a chapel in very
short notice. In fact, in some places, you can walk in without a
reservation, depending on how busy they are. I wouldn‘t advise
this, however. Better to have a reservation and not take a
gamble.
